Title: How to Keep Trees Disease-Free in Springville, Alabama

As residents of Springville, Alabama, we are fortunate to be surrounded by an abundance of beautiful trees that not only enhance the natural beauty of our community but also provide numerous environmental benefits. However, just like any living organism, trees are susceptible to diseases that can threaten their health and longevity. In order to preserve the health and vitality of our beloved trees, it is important to take proactive measures to keep them disease-free.

Here are some tips to help you maintain healthy trees in Springville, Alabama:

1. Regular Inspection: Make it a habit to inspect your trees regularly for any signs of disease or pest infestation. Look for symptoms such as discolored leaves, unusual growths, or visible damage to the bark. Early detection is key to preventing the spread of disease.

2. Proper Pruning: Pruning is essential for maintaining the health and structure of trees. Remove dead or diseased branches to prevent the spread of infection. Be sure to use sharp, clean tools to avoid causing further damage to the tree.

3. Adequate Watering: Proper watering is crucial for the health of trees, especially during dry spells. Be mindful of the specific water requirements of each tree species and avoid overwatering, as this can lead to root rot and other diseases.

4. Mulching: Mulch around the base of trees can help retain moisture, regulate soil temperature, and suppress weeds. However, be sure not to pile mulch too high against the trunk, as this can create a moist environment that promotes disease.

5. Disease Prevention: Consider using preventative measures such as applying fungicides or insecticides to protect your trees from common diseases and pests. Consult with a certified arborist to determine the best course of action for your specific tree species.

6. Professional Tree Care: Regularly scheduled tree care by a certified arborist can help ensure the overall health and longevity of your trees. They can provide expert advice on proper maintenance practices and diagnose any potential issues early on.

By following these tips and staying vigilant in caring for your trees, you can help keep them disease-free and thriving in Springville, Alabama. Remember that healthy trees not only beautify our surroundings but also contribute to a healthier environment for all residents to enjoy.
